Whitefish Police Calls Feb. 15-21.

Monday, Feb. 15

3:26 p.m. A medium-sized dog was running into traffic on Spokane Avenue.

4:32 p.m. A load of wood fell out of a pickup on Highway 93 South.

Tuesday, Feb. 16

1:17 a.m. Report of a suspicious man wandering around a house on Waverly Place. When motion lights came on the man ran to his vehicle and drove away.

2:07 a.m. Report of yelling and possible gun shots heard on East 2nd Street. An intoxicated man was advised to keep it down.

2:55 p.m. A woman reported being harassed by a man she met through an online dating site. She was advised to apply for a no contact order.

4:56 p.m. A business on Highway 93 South was following up on a previous theft. The same suspect returned again and stole some more items.

Wednesday, Feb. 17

12:12 p.m. Beer bottles and needles were found in front of a store on East 1st Street.

3:46 p.m. A caller identified a suspect involved in a theft from a store at the mall.

Thursday, Feb. 18

8:44 a.m. A saxophone stolen from Houston Circle was found at a music store.

1:20 a.m. A caller reported her iPad stolen while on a flight. The devise was located in Atlanta.

3:55 p.m. A Kalispell Avenue resident was advised to not feed the deer.

10:17 p.m. Report of kids smoking marijuana in a car parked along Wisconsin Avenue.

Friday, Feb. 19

3:33 a.m. Report of loud music and banging around at a home on Denver Street. The resident was advised to keep it down.

5:48 p.m. Report of a verbal dispute on West 8th Street.

11:33 p.m. Four men were involved in a fist fight downtown. All was quiet when police arrived.

Saturday, Feb. 20

1:02 a.m. Bouncers broke up a large group of people fighting downtown.

3:02 a.m. A Colorado Avenue resident reported an unknown man on the front porch kicking his window. The suspect had a bloody hand and was staggering around. Police charged the man with criminal mischief and took him to the hospital.

9:58 a.m. A vehicle was egged on Waverly Place.

12:40 p.m. Report of a woman sleeping inside a vehicle with a broken window parked on Highway 93 South. The woman reportedly had a heroine kit with her and admitted to using drugs.

12:43 p.m. An iPod was stolen from an unlocked vehicle on Armory Road.

Sunday, Feb. 21

2:15 p.m. Report of a hit and run on Dakota Avenue.
